Vegetable Sausage Rolls
Meat free Sausage Roll that is just as delicious as the traditional version
Ingredients
- 2 Cups Rolled Oats
- 2 Cups Grated Tasty Cheese
- 1 Zucchini, grated
- 1 Carrots, grated
- 1/2 Onion, grated
- 3 Tbsp Soy Sauce
- 1/4 Cup Fresh Parsley, chopped
- 3 Eggs
- 3 Tbsp Tomato Sauce or Relish
- 3 Tbsp BBQ Sauce
- 4 Sheets Puff Pastry
- Pinch Salt
- Pinch Pepper
Instructions
- In a large bowl combine all ingredients except pastry and mix well until thoroughly combined.
- Cover and place in the fridge for a couple of hours or overnight, this allows the excess liquid to soak into the oats.
- Preheat the oven 190 C
- Cut each pastry sheet in half.
- Place the sausage roll mixture on the pastry and roll the pastry over, cut each roll into the size you require I usually get 6-8 smaller pastries.
- Bake the sausage rolls on lined baking trays for 30-40 minutes.
Notes
You can change up the vegetables to whatever you have and also change the sauce or herb variety for a different flavour.
